WebArea Moment of Inertia. The second moment of area, more commonly known as the moment of inertia, I, of a cross section is an indication of a structural member's ability to resist bending. (Note 1) I x and I y are the moments of inertia about the x- and y- axes, respectively, and are calculated by: I x = ∫ y 2 dA. I y = ∫ x 2 dA. WebA cross section is a view created by cutting through the short side of the building. The section plane lies perpendicular to a longitudinal section, and it’s used to show the inside of a building the same way. For square buildings, objects, and assemblies, a cross section can mean any section cut horizontally or vertically showing the inside.
